Tokushima - A Gateway to Natural Wonders and Cultural Heritage
Tokushima is known for its stunning natural landscapes and vibrant cultural scene, particularly famous for the Awa Odori dance festival. Visitors can immerse themselves in both the scenic beauty and the local traditions that characterize this enchanting region.
- Naruto Whirlpools: Located in the Naruto Strait, these powerful tidal whirlpools are a marvel of nature that can be experienced by boat or from viewing platforms. They are most prominent during certain tidal conditions, making for a spectacular sight.
- Awa Odori Kaikan: This cultural center offers visitors the chance to learn about and participate in the famous Awa Odori dance. Visitors can watch live performances and even take part in dance workshops to experience this traditional art form firsthand.
- Shikoku Pilgrimage: The Shikoku Pilgrimage is a 1,200-kilometer trail that takes you to 88 temples associated with the Buddhist monk Kobo Daishi. It attracts not only spiritual seekers but also those looking to soak in the beautiful scenery of Tokushima’s countryside.
